BEST Wassail Recipe
Ingredients
- 8 cups apple cider
- 2 sticks cinnamon
- 1/3 teaspoon nutmeg
- 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1/3 cup honey
- 1 1/2 teaspoon lemon peel
- 5 tablespoons lemon juice
- 3 1/2 cups pineapple juice
Instructions
- In large pot combine all ingredients and simmer to blend ingredients.HINT: We grate the peel of a lemon and squeeze the juice of the same lemon to give us what we need for this recipe.
